Ski trip
Hi guys,
I'm doing a little homework on a resort les menuires France. A colleague is taking his family mid April and had offered me my wife 6&4yr old to join them. We would be driving which I'm a little dubious about as the m135i isn't a mountain goat. Wife and I board, kids never been to the slopes, any info greatly appreciated, Lee |

The trip would be great fun in a m135! Been up to the Three Valleys in an E39 M5 with Dunlop SP Sport Maxx a few times. No issue, roads are usually clear.
There are usually loads of things for young ones - ski lessons or otherwise. Haven't stayed in Les Menuires but the Three Valleys are epic skiing. |

its a great location/area, great access to all the other areas of 3valleys, and should have plenty of snow in April too. its the cheapest (IMO) of the various resorts in the 3valley region.
its not the prettiest resort, but its effective in terms of location, and there will be loads for the kids to do snow wise as well. driving is fairly easy, roads are good and usually well cleared. Its a bit of a trek from Calais, but the motorway system is fair more relaxing experience than in UK! as you and wife are already seasoned, you know what your doing when you get to the resort, my suggestion for the kids would be to take them to an artificial slope a couple of times before you go, if they can ski on that then doing it on the real stuff is a doddle and they'll feel a bit more confident when they get there. |

I'm not long back from Val D'isere. I may take the car next time as I saw more BMW's than anything else! Even saw 2 M135i's and an E92 M3. There was a BMW ice track driving thing there too.
The roads were clear and the exception may be the last mile to the resort if there has been heavy snow over night. The drive looked like it would be great fun if I wasn't on a coach! In April it should be a great drive especially with longer daytime. It is a long drive though, I'd definitely get the early ferry. |
